What Is a Feature Wall?
A feature wall, also known as an accent wall, is a wall within a room that is designed to be the focal point. It is typically differentiated from other walls through the use of color, texture, patterns, or materials. Unlike painting an entire room, a feature wall allows you to add impact without overwhelming the space.
It can be subtle or bold, modern or traditional, and it can be created in virtually any roomliving rooms, bedrooms, kitchens, offices, or even bathrooms.

Types of Feature Walls
There are endless design possibilities when it comes to feature walls. Here are some popular types to consider:
Painted Feature Walls
The simplest and most affordable option. A bold paint color on one wall can instantly energize a room. Choose a hue that contrasts or complements the existing palette for best results.
Wallpapered Walls
Wallpaper offers texture, pattern, and depth. From floral designs to geometric prints, modern wallpapers are stylish and easy to apply or remove. This option is perfect for adding elegance or drama.
Wood Paneling and Cladding
Wooden feature walls bring warmth and texture. Options include shiplap, reclaimed wood, slatted panels, and wood veneer sheets. This style works especially well in rustic, Scandinavian, or mid-century interiors.
Stone or Brick Walls
Exposed brick or faux stone panels create an industrial or earthy feel. These materials add tactile interest and work beautifully in lofts, modern farmhouse designs, and eclectic spaces.
Tile Feature Walls
In kitchens or bathrooms, feature walls using tiles can add both color and functionality. Mosaic, subway, or patterned tiles can create an artistic and waterproof focal point.
Mural or Artwork Walls
A painted mural, large canvas, or curated gallery of art and photographs can make an emotional and visual impact. Its ideal for creative individuals who want to tell a story through design.
Mirror or Glass Accents
Mirrored feature walls can make small rooms feel larger and brighter. Glass tiles or panels also add sophistication, especially in modern or minimalist settings.

Tips for Designing the Perfect Feature Wall
Choose the Right Wall
Pick a wall that naturally draws the eyeusually the one directly opposite the rooms entrance or behind a significant piece of furniture.
Balance Is Key
Dont overload the feature wall with too many elements. It should stand out, but also blend harmoniously with the rooms overall design.
Coordinate with Existing Decor
Consider your furniture, flooring, and accessories when selecting colors, patterns, and textures for the feature wall.
Use Lighting Strategically
Accent lighting such as spotlights, LED strips, or pendant lights can highlight the feature wall and enhance its impact.
Keep It Functional
In multi-use spaces, consider how the wall supports the function of the room. For example, in a workspace, you might opt for a chalkboard or cork wall for notes and inspiration.
Trends in Feature Walls
Biophilic Designs
Bringing nature indoors is a growing trend. Green walls, moss panels, or botanical wallpapers help create a calming, organic atmosphere.
Monochrome Textures
Rather than relying on color, many designers are now using varying textures in the same color tonelike matte and gloss finishes or fabric and plasterfor a subtle, elegant effect.
Digital Murals and Prints
Technology now allows for custom-printed wall murals with anything from digital art to personal photographs, offering one-of-a-kind designs.
Interactive or Functional Walls
Magnetic chalkboards, pegboards, or storage-integrated walls blend design with everyday utilityperfect for families or workspaces.
